Conor McGregor is once again stirring the pot with Dustin Poirier on social media after being defeated by "The Diamond" twice in-a-row. McGregor continues to bring up Poirier's wife online, as he hopes to get back to fighting shape after surgery.
Yesterday McGregor posted then quickly deleted a series of tweets aimed at Dustin's child. He tweeted a picture of Dustin's daughter followed by the word "Gonezo".
